What companies run services between Porto, Portugal and Naples, Italy?

You can take a train from Porto Campanha to Napoli Centrale via Vigo Guixar, Barcelona-Sants, Lyon Part Dieu, and Milano Centrale in around 34h 12m. Alternatively, easyJet flies from Francisco De Sá Carneiro Airport (OPO) to Naples Airport (NAP) once a week.
